Born in Moscow, Russia, Kristina Soboleva was drawn to art from a young age. Growing up in a family of artists and musicians, Soboleva was encouraged to explore her creative side, and she began painting at the age of 5. Her early influences ranged from classical Russian art to modern Western masters, and she was particularly drawn to the works of Frida Kahlo, Egon Schiele, and Mark Rothko. kristina soboleva gallery exclusive
